  • Ergot alkaloids are mycotoxins produced predominantly by fungi of the Claviceps genus, which mainly affect cereals and wild grasses. Ingestion of ergot alkaloids can cause severe health problems in humans and animals. Thus, there is a need for methods that allow determination of these dangerous toxins. A liquid chromatography-tandem mass spectrometry (LC-MS/MS) method has been developed for the simultaneous determination of eight ergot alkaloids: ergosine, ergocornine, ergocryptine and ergocristine and their corresponding epimers as well. Mean recovery, precision, matrix effects and limits of quantification (LOQ) have been assessed for cereal and grass matrices within the method validation. Sample preparation has been based on modified QuEChERS approach. The presented method was used to inspect various feed samples. Ergot alkaloids were found in 31 out of 113 samples investigated.
